The University of Bridgeport is an international, doctoral-intensive, comprehensive university, offering award winning academic programs in a variety of innovative undergraduate and graduate degree programs The Master of Science in Mechanical Engineering is designed to enhance the skills of individuals with a strong mathematical, scientific or technical background for entry into the profession at an advanced level, to obtain a position in industry or consulting, and/or for further study leading to a Doctorate Degree This degree program provides advanced study in contemporary and emerging Mechanical Engineering fields as well as in the traditional mechanical engineering field. Admission Requirements Program Prerequisites -Bachelor of Science degree, or its equivalent, in engineering or a related field from an accredited university or recognized international institution -Recommended cumulative undergraduate grade point average of 2.8 or higher Required Materials -University of Bridgeport graduate application -$50 application fee (non-refundable) -Checks or money orders should be made payable to the University of Bridgeport -Official transcripts from every school attended -Two recommendation letters -Letters must be signed and come from employers, professors or professional associates -Personal statement -In 250 – 500 words, detail why you are seeking this degree, how you expect to apply your degree to your professional career after graduation and why you seek to pursue your degree through the University of Bridgeport -Resume Deadlines Completed application and all supporting documents must be received by: -August 1 for the fall semester -December 15 for the spring semester Program Tracks • Design Engineering Computer Aided Engineering Design (CAD) Machinery and Mechanical System Design Advanced CAD Projects Materials and Process Selection Computer Aided Engineering (CAE) Biomedical Instrument Design • Manufacturing Engineering and Management Computer Aided Manufacturing (CAM) and NC Machining Advanced CAM and Automation Production Technology and Techniques Advanced Manufacturing Manufacturing Strategy and Lean Manufacturing Manufacturing Management Supply Chain Management and Logistics Modeling and Simulation • Mechanics and Materials Finite Element Method Advanced Composite Materials Mechanics of Composite Material Fatigue and Fracture Mechanics Advanced Mechanics of Materials Biomechanics Polymer Nanocomposites Nanofabrication with Soft Materials • Thermal Fluid Systems and Sustainable Energy Computational Fluid Dynamics Advanced Fluid Dynamics Advanced Heat Transfer Physiological Fluid Dynamics Aerodynamics and Hydrodynamics in Sports Electronics Thermal Management Heating, Ventilation and Air Conditioning System Design Alternative Energy Technology Interdisciplinary areas • Biomechanical Engineering (Biotransport, Biomechanics, Biomaterials, and Bioinstrument Design) • Mechatronics and Automation (Advanced Dynamics, Advanced Vibrations, Control, and Robotics) • Micro and Nano Engineering (Microfluidics, MEMS, and Nanomaterials) • Sports and Aeronautical Engineering (Aerodynamics, Design, and Manufacturing) Contact Detail: University of Bridgeport 126 Park Ave, Bridgeport, CT 06604, United States Phone: +1 800-392-3582
